Subject: Key rotation for GridWeave crossword service

Hi all — welcome to the team. As part of our quarterly security routine, we've rotated the API key for GridWeave, the internal service that generates and validates crossword grids. The old key stops working Friday. Update your local `.env` before then; nothing else changes. The new key is below.

API key for kafop-fafof: qvz3-4pw

Tracing in Netherspan: every plugin must propagate the X-Span-Chain header unchanged. Drop it and traces fragment silently — the collector won't warn you. Use the provided middleware; don't roll your own. Sampling is decided upstream, never override it. To unlock the trace inspector sandbox for your plugin account, enter the recovery passphrase below.

strongbox words: wenix-ulador

Per-tenant rate quotas on Lanternvale are managed by the Quotastack service account. If that account is locked out — usually after a failed quota sync — tenants will see stale limits but traffic still flows. To recover, open the Quotastack recovery console from the support jump box and select the affected shard. Confirm the tenant count matches the dashboard before proceeding. The console asks for the recovery passphrase, which follows:

unlock words, hahip-baduf: holwyn-istath-julvan

## Who to ping about GiftNote

Welcome aboard! GiftNote is our donation-receipt mailer for the Larchfield Fund. Template tweaks go to the comms folks; delivery failures and bounce weirdness go to the platform crew. Don't push template changes on Fridays — receipts batch over the weekend. For anything GiftNote-related, start with the address below.

billing contact of kaweg-tajeg = drudor.lamion.oliath@torvalabs.test

02:14 — ThumbForge queue depth crossed 40k; consumer pods were alive but idle. Root cause traced to a malformed job payload that pinned the deserializer in a retry loop, starving the worker pool. Dropping the poison message restored throughput within four minutes. A payload schema check now rejects such jobs at enqueue. Reviewer: the fix and the new guard are in the candidate build referenced by the token below.

session token of bawep-yadup = htk21_528abd376e3c5a4ec24a1